I was wondering the same thing.
The final EIS was released in July 2012 as promised. It solidified their preference for "alternative 6" which still expands to the west, but is a shared use plan. They'd take ~140,000 acres, but allow public access to ~38,000 acres (including the Hammers) when they weren't training on it. They estimate 10 months a year of public access. Our very own Soggy Lake is still within the area they want, but I can't tell if it would be part of the proposed shared use land. If you look at this map, Soggy Lake is just to the right of their "B" marker: http://www.29palms.marines.mil/Porta...ong%5B1%5D.pdf The Record of Decision (the final step) was slated for November or December, but it hasn't happened yet and is now being pushed into January.
